Anyone who knows me knows that I love and admire the 125-year-old company Nintendo. Yesterday president and CEO Satoru Iwata passed away at age 55.

For nearly a decade Nintendo has hosted a unique Q&A column called "Iwata Asks" where Iwata interviews other game developers. I can think of no better way to celebrate the life and mourn the passing of the man than to read the archives, as the columns are fascinating and enlightening and Iwata's personality really shines through them all.

No matter your console allegiance, your favorite genres, your view on Nintendo, or any other baggage you may have, let us all take a while to give such an industry pioneer the respect he deserves.
